    Cabinetvision Cabinet Assembly reports, need to make something similar

    My company has posed quite a challenge to me.  I need to make something similar to the cabinet assy reports from CV, which at the touch of a button prints out "A" size drawing of each individual cabinet (1 dimensioned elevation) with full cutlist for that cabinet. 

    This is something that MUST be automated.  

    any Ideas?

    This is currently a goal of mine as well but I am still in the process of learning Crystal Reports so I haven't made much progress.  The product detail report has most everything that you need already but is not well organised and takes too many pages.  The hardest part would be automating the drawing of a dimensioned picture for the report.  It seems that there should be a way to do this but for now I am using "Draw selected as 3D with machining" and the MV product detail tools to make a meta-file of the product.  This way the product report and labels have an actual picture of the product not a generic one.  If MV would create a tool to make and dimension the pictures the rest would be fairly easy...

    Reports are the only thing that I miss from CV.  Granted, you can't customize their product detail report and I would have changes somethings on it but overall I have found the quality and variety of reports from MV to be a little disapointing :(

    You need to make sure that your panel optimizer is set to "none" for the pictures to be created when reports are processed (I am not sure why).  Then, when you process reports, a folder called "face frame pictures" will be created inside the job folder and populated with the pictures.

    Yes, the reports generated from MV are now included in the FF library build 10. The Face Frame Report.mrt was having some problems displaying the wmf image of the face frame. This was addressed in program update 67.103.18.
